Monrovia, May 19 -- Liberia has embarked on a new chapter in its football rebuild with the appointment of Moroccan UEFA Pro License holder Mohammed A. Erradi as the head coach of the men's national football team, the Lone Star.

Erradi was officially unveiled on Monday at the headquarters of the Liberia Football Association (LFA) in Congo Town, where he penned a three-year contract committing his future to the national team through 2029.

His immediate mandate is clear: guide Liberia toward qualification for the 2027 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ON).
